Abstract
- With the continuous increase of people' s requirements for the fit and comfort of clothing, the research on human shape characteristics and classification has become the focus of research in the field of clothing. The study of the shape characteristics of the breast is an important part of the research on human body shape and morphology of clothing field. The shape characteristics of female breasts have a significant impact on tops' fit. Therefore, it is of great significance to carry out research on the shape characteristics of female breasts in different regions and different age groups. In the existing research. there arc few studies on the breast shape of young females in Northeast China. Therefore, this paper takes young females in Northeast China as the research object to study and analyze the characteristics and classification of their breasts. In the research of clothing fit, the shape characteristics of the breasts under the state of wearing a bra are an important basis for coniaructing fit clothing and ready-to-wear design. In this paper. 328 young females aged 18 - 25 years old in Northeast China were randomly selected, and anthropometric measurements were performed using the VITUS 3D body scanner. Referring to GB/T 16160 - 2017 • Anthropometric Definitions and Methods for Garment'. 17 characteristic variables such as chest circumference, lower chestcircumference and chest width were extracted. And 311 valid experimental samples were finally determined through the data outlier test. Using principal component analysis. we obtained five principal component factors. namely: girth factor, distance factor, height factor, chest circumference difference factor and shape factor. Using the principal component factors as the classification indexes, four types of chest shape were obtained through K-means cluster analysis. Among them, females of the first type have a relatively uniform body shape and a flat chest shape. Females of the second type are thin, with plump. straight and gathered breasts. Females of the third type are slightly fat. with plump. gathered, and slightly sagging breasts. Women of the fourth type are relatively symmetrical in shape. and their breasts are plump. slightly expanded. and sagging. The proportions of the experimental samples of the four types of breast shapes were 21. 9%. 32. Ili. 26. 7%. and 19. 3%. respectively. According to the principal component factor analysis and the shape characteristics of human breasts. bust circumference and breast distance were selected as the independent variables. The stepwise regression method was used to commie' the regression models of various breast shape characteristic variables. The validity of the chest characteristic regression equations was verified by variance analysis and residual analysis. The verification results show that the chest regression models of each body type are ideal. The study found that among the five principal component factors, the girth factor and the distance factor have a greater impact on the shape of du chest. Through descriptive statistical analysis and comparison of 3D models, it is proved that the shape characteristics of the four chest types in the cluster are obvious. The for types of chest shape regression models established by stepwise regression analysis have obvious differences in structure. which further illustrates the difference between human body shape categories and breast shape. This paper studies the breast shape classification and regression modeling of young females in Northeast China under the cc edition of their wearing a bra. It provides reference for the research on breast shape and clothing fit of young females in this area. Due to the limited sample sin of the experiment. the accuracy of the chest shape classification and regression model in this study needs to be improved. and the results of the study still have certain limitations. The shape characteristics of the breasts of women wearing bras are the basis for the research on the structure and fit of the tops. Based on the research on chest shape. a parametric 3D model of the chest and human body and a digital avatar can be constructed in the future. At the same time, relevant research such as clothing fit structure design, clothing virtual design. and virtual fitting can be carried out. [ABSTRACT FROM AUTHOR]
